Morrison Data Services Awarded Smart Meter Contract with So Energy

12th October 2020

Morrison Data Services (MDS), the UK’s leading utility data services provider to the energy and water market and a part of M Group Services, has been awarded a smart meter contract with growing renewable energy supplier, So Energy.

Under the terms of the three-year contract, MDS will deliver meter reading, data management (NHHDC/DA) and SMETS2 smart metering installation services in selected geographies across the midlands and the north of the UK on behalf of So Energy.

MDS expect to complete up to 125k installations over the full term of the contract, also providing full 24hr emergency MOP/MAM coverage.
